Building Meaningful Connections through Professional Associations

Professional associations play a crucial role in the career development and networking opportunities for individuals in various industries. These organizations provide a platform for professionals to connect, learn, and grow together. Building meaningful connections through professional associations can have a significant impact on your career progression and personal development.

Why Join a Professional Association?

Joining a professional association offers numerous benefits, including:

  • Networking opportunities with industry peers and experts
  • Access to educational resources, workshops, and conferences
  • Career advancement through mentorship programs and job listings
  • Professional development through certifications and training programs
  • Stay updated on industry trends and best practices

Building Meaningful Connections

Here are some tips on how to build meaningful connections through professional associations:

  1. Attend Events: Participate in conferences, seminars, and networking events organized by the association to meet new people and exchange ideas.
  2. Volunteer: Get involved in committees or volunteer for leadership roles within the association to expand your network and showcase your skills.
  3. Engage Online: Join online forums or social media groups of the association to interact with members from different regions and backgrounds.
  4. Seek Mentorship: Connect with experienced professionals in your field through mentorship programs offered by the association to gain valuable insights and guidance.
